We were considering second hand cars including ex-demo or government auction cars. Cars can be bought from private sellers, official car dealers, car dealers which can be found at Five Dock, Parramatta Road and Blacktown in Sydney just to name a few.

Suttons City Rosebery was our final choice.
+ It is an official authorised car dealer. Though we are paying a higher price but this is probably the safest option. If you are a car expert, it probably won't matter!
+ It is the nearest to our apartment in Sydney. Otherwise, the usual steps would be to shortlist potential cars online, make an appointment with the dealer, and train/bus down.

We purchased a second hand Hyundai Elantra Active model. These are the list of things that affect our decision:
+ Based on the available second hand cars on sale for Toyota and Hyundai, we considered the price, mileage, location and reputation of dealer.
+ Doing research on Whirlpool forum, Google and Productreview.com.au, features such as cruise control which is important for road trips, fuel efficiency, servicing of the car model, reliability of the engine and functions of the car make, the popularity of the car model which means it will be easier for us to sell it off, etc.
+ Understanding if the second hand car has reverse car sensors or cameras, tinting for windows, or any paint protection performed previously. We neglected these areas and only learnt about it after we purchased our car.
